Wow, that is not an easy headline to write. And the story -- passed along by RandBallsStu -- is so convoluted that you probably just need to read it (mind the language, of course).
The upshot? The 9-11 truther who crashed the postgame Super Bowl podium is named Matthew Mills. But a couple of different radio stations -- including WCCO -- apparently did interviews afterward with a different Matthew Mills.
It's basically the worst nightmare of a host/reporter.
But it does make for an interesting tale.
